 Drive circuit for power operation of a movable part of a vehicle coachwork

A control device for a motor-driven closure panel, for instance an automobile sunroof panel whose closed position is an intermediate position between an open, retracted position and another open, pivoted position, the circuitry for the reversible motor including an impulse relay operating a control switch in one of the two motor connections, the relay coil being connected in parallel to the motor and between the control switch and the pole reversing switch, a position-responsive switch cutting off the relay circuit whenever the panel moves out of its closed position and energizing the impulse relay whenever the panel reaches the closed position. An improved switch arrangement prevents the panel from being stuck in a position in which the reversible motor becomes inoperative.

DETAILED DESCRIPTION The problem which the invention seeks to overcome is to so improve the operating mechanism according to the said Patent that the above-described situation cannot occur, enabling the control winding of the impulse relay to receive a pulse even when the second switch is open.
According to the invention, the second switch has an additional contact which with the second switch when open connects the appropriate terminal of the control winding with the lead connecting the motor and the first switch.
If the above-described case now occurs, whereby the second switch is opened by overtravelling the closed position on operating the pole reversal switch, the control winding of the impulse relay can now receive a pulse via the electric motor winding which closes the first switch and supplies power to the electric motor.
This function is ensured due to the fact that the motor winding has a much lower resistance than the control winding of the impulse relay.
